Potassium trifluoro(5-methylfuran-2-yl)boranuide (CAS No. 1111213-54-7) is a highly specialized organoboron compound with the molecular formula C5H5BF3KO. This potassium-based boranuide derivative features a trifluoro-(5-methylfuran-2-yl)borate anion, making it a valuable reagent for advanced synthetic and catalytic applications. With a purity grade suitable for research and industrial use, this compound is rigorously tested to ensure consistency and performance in demanding chemical processes. Ideal for use in cross-coupling reactions, ligand synthesis, and as a precursor in organometallic chemistry, it is supplied as a stable solid under inert conditions to maintain integrity. Store in a cool, dry place away from moisture and incompatible materials.

  • CAS No: 1111213-54-7
  • Molecular Formula: C5H5BF3KO
  • Molecular Weight: 188.00
  • Exact Mass: 188.0022609
  • Monoisotopic Mass: 188.0022609
  • IUPAC Name: potassium;trifluoro-(5-methylfuran-2-yl)boranuide
  • SMILES: [B-](C1=CC=C(O1)C)(F)(F)F.[K+]
  • Synonyms: POTASSIUM TRIFLUORO(5-METHYLFURAN-2-YL)BORANUIDE, 875-197-7, 1111213-54-7, Potassium trifluoro(5-methylfuran-2-yl)borate, POTASSIUM 5-METHYLFURAN-2-TRIFLUOROBORATE

Application

Potassium trifluoro(5-methylfuran-2-yl)boranuide is primarily used as a key intermediate in Suzuki-Miyaura cross-coupling reactions, enabling the formation of carbon-carbon bonds in complex organic syntheses. Its stability and reactivity make it suitable for pharmaceutical research, particularly in the development of furan-containing bioactive molecules. Additionally, it serves as a versatile building block in materials science for designing boron-doped organic frameworks and functionalized polymers.
